"Citra Smash" American IPA beer recipe by Joel. BIAB, ABV 6.68%, IBU 47.04, SRM 4.59, Fermentables: (Pale 2-Row, Acidulated Malt, Cane Sugar) Hops: (Citra) Other: (Gypsum)
